About us
Kwikiriza Charity Foundation is a Not-for-profit Community Based Organization established on the 10th August 2020 and registered as a Community Based Organization (CBO) with the office of the City Community Development Office under Registration No. JC/060/CBO/2024 and Well known for its commitment to work with marginalized sections of the society and empower them to attain dignified quality life.
We are based in Jinja, Uganda and working in rural poor populations since 2020 providing education for children in rural areas, helping young people develop the right skills to find jobs and start their own businesses and empower women to help transform their local communities as well as meeting their socio-economic needs.
Our goal is to structurally improve and increase access to basic social and economic livelihoods of people in marginalized communities.
Mission
Kwikiriza Charity Foundation is run and led by community members for community members. We aim to empower the local community by providing resources to support them in education and life. We do this in a number of ways: We set up local businesses to generate income that we use to sustain our programmes and projects. We do this in a number of ways: Educating orphans and vulnerable children; Providing life skills training to young people; Supplying resources to enable women to work; Medical Support; Nutritional support, etc.
Vision
To see rural communities in Uganda develop using sustainable solutions that give hope and dignity to the most vulnerable.
